I have been thinking about the 'Merit Rating' issue and wish to speculate as follows: The 'SG' employs the numbers 0-9 for each selection category beginning with academic qualifications. A course that considers only 3 heads of qualifications will therefore bear the MR 000 for the lowest and 999 for the highest merit rating. The first zero meaning no academic qualification and the other two representing other criteria such as work experience, proof of previous academic curiosity and so on and so forth. A course that considers more could bear the MR 0 000 for the lowest and 9 999 for the highest.

Since according to Studera.nu the MR will only be displaced for applicants who have met the basic admission qualification to the courses however, i.e. academic, there would no result in MR that begins with a zero.

I would therefore speculate that an applicant for say the International Commercial Arbitration master course in the University of Stockholm with the MR 999 stands a good chance of admission subject only to class capacity.

This could mean that should there be more candidates with the highest MR qualifications than the class can take the SG could resort to random drawing methods such as the use of computer sorting and those who get selected in those circumstances could be considered to be the 'lucky' ones.
